Then, you can choose a different creature within range, including yourself, to ...Something else to consider that I don't think has been mentioned, the noise factor. A person hit with Hold Person is paralyzed, and so can't make any noise, while someone hit with Tasha's Hideous Laughter busts out laughing hard, rolling and clattering around. In combat this doesn't really make a difference, but in a stealth-type scenario it ...Wizard wins initiative. Wizard casts Tasha’s Hideous Laughter on an enemy. The …Tasha's Hideous Laughter works well against Wizards because it incapacitates them and they LOSE CONCENTRATION. Being incapacitated or killed. You lose concentration on a spell if you are incapacitated or if you die. This makes a lot of sense in the fiction -- since the wizard is LOLing and ROFLing.A creature of your choice that you can see within range perceives everything as hilariously funny and falls into fits of laughter if this spell affects it. Because Tasha's Hideous Laughter imposes the Incapacitated condition with no extras, or stipulations beyond the intelligence requirement, there no monsters which are immune to it outside of really dumb things and Modrons. (Axiomatic Mind should stop it) Thematically, everything but really dumb things and apparently Modrons have a sense of humor.Tasha's Hideous Laughter [ Fou rire de Tasha ] level 1 - enchantment Casting Time: 1 action Range: 30 feet Components: V, S, M (tiny tarts and a feather that is waved in the air) Duration: Concentration, up to 1 minuteTasha's Hideous Laughter, 1st level Enchantment (Wizard, Bard). Overall Notes: At the surface, Otto’s irresistible dance may look unappealing because Tasha’s hideous laughter can be seen as a substitution at a 1st-level spell slot. Well, the biggest thing that makes Otto’s worthy of a 6th-level slot is that there is no save, the effect just happens. This allows a whole round of attacks with advantage ...Creature typically means 'not an object', so yes- a monster/humanoid/animal.
